"It's always great to have cards in your sleeve because these days it's everything. There's so many things you have to do. Any extra is helpful because if you can play an instrument, it only adds to the soup.”Discover insights from Tony winner Christopher Gatelli, known for his work on Newsies and Schmigadoon. This episode explores the evolution of musical theater, the characteristics of today's triple threats, and the power of mentorship in the arts.In this episode:Chris Gatelli shares his journey to winning a Tony and his recent projectsThe changing landscape of musical theater The importance of ensemble work and versatile performers in modern productionsReflections on mentorship and the influence of choreographer Scott SalmanBehind-the-scenes stories from Schmigadoon and NewsiesThe impact of theater education and training todayInsights into directing and choreographing for TV vs. BroadwayThe future of musical theater and emerging talent Tony Winning Christopher Gattelli shares his views on Schmigadoon, the Broadway show and the TV show he staged prior.
